Cracks may develop in the upper compensating cylinder mounting brackets at the rear of the boom in certain TH82 Telehandlers. These cracks may appear on either the front or rear of the mounting bracket and need to be repaired.

Rework Procedure
1. Inspect for cracks in channel section (1) as shown in Illustration 1.
2. Grind a groove in the cracked area, as shown in Illustration 1, Detail B. Dimension 3 is 60 degrees.
3. The area around the radius in channel sides must be ground smooth.
NOTE: Ensure the area prepared for welding is free of all contaminants (i.e. dirt, dust, oil, paint and grease) before welding.
4. Weld the above repared area using either manual or MIG welding.
Manual Metallic Arc Welding:
MIG Welding Wire:
5. The welded area should be ground flush with the mating surfaces.
